Unveiling the Inner Core's Secrets

The inner core, often misunderstood, is not a solid rock but a sphere of solid iron-rich metal. This revelation challenges our initial assumptions about the Earth's core. Imagine a metal object, inferred through intricate scientific methods, sitting at the heart of our planet. It's a fascinating concept, especially when considering its size and mass.

What makes this particularly fascinating is the contrast between the inner and outer cores. While both are primarily iron-rich, the inner core remains solid due to extreme pressure, even at high temperatures. It's like a metal fortress, withstanding the heat and pressure that would melt most substances.

A Growing Metal Sphere

One of the most intriguing aspects is the inner core's growth. As Earth gradually cools, liquid metal from the outer core solidifies and adds to the inner core's surface. This process, though slow on a human timescale, is significant in planetary terms. It's like watching a time-lapse of Earth's evolution, with the inner core expanding by a mere millimetre each year.

Impact on Earth's Magnetic Field

The growth of the inner core is not just about adding layers; it influences the geodynamo, the process that generates Earth's magnetic field. The solidification of iron-rich metal leaves behind lighter elements in the outer core, creating chemical differences that drive convection. This convection, in turn, powers the magnetic field, highlighting the intricate connection between the core's composition and Earth's protective shield.

A Hidden Object, Yet Well-Studied

Despite its inaccessibility, the inner core is not a speculative concept. Seismology, a powerful tool, allows us to study this hidden object. Earthquake waves provide a unique window into the Earth's interior, revealing the inner core's composition and structure. Earth's Ongoing Evolution

The inner core is a reminder that Earth is still evolving. From its hot, molten beginnings, the planet has separated into metal and silicate, with the core continuing to lose heat and shape its surroundings. The growth of the inner core is a testament to this ongoing process, with the planet literally building itself from the inside out.
